Microsoft Access Club Access超初心者対象Forum Access初・中級者対象Forum Access VBA Tips Forum DAO、ADO、SQL Forum

     

リストへもどる

投稿記事の一括表示

タイトルフォーム画面の「#Num!」を空白表示したい
記事No83324
投稿日: 2018/07/21(Sat) 13:54
投稿者とむぱぱ
OS:Windows10
Access Version:2013

初心者ゆえよろしくお願いいたします。
フォーム画面上の「#Num!」を空白表示したいのですが、
どうしてもわかりません。

フォーム画面に、
フィールド「売上」、「原価」、「収益率」があります。

テーブルで、
「収益率」は、集計フィールドで、
式は、「[金額]/[原価]」
結果の型は、「倍精度浮動小数点型」
です。

フォーム画面で、
「売上」も「原価」も0ぜロだと、「#Num!」と表示されます。

この場合、空白表示にしたいのです。

ご伝授の程よろしくお願いいたします。

タイトルRe: フォーム画面の「#Num!」を空白表示したい
記事No83325
投稿日: 2018/07/22(Sun) 12:01
投稿者AccessKid
IIf([金額] And [原価],[金額]/[原価],Null)
では?


> フォーム画面に、
> フィールド「売上」、「原価」、「収益率」があります。
> 
> テーブルで、
> 「収益率」は、集計フィールドで、
> 式は、「[金額]/[原価]」
> 結果の型は、「倍精度浮動小数点型」
> です。
> 
> フォーム画面で、
> 「売上」も「原価」も0ぜロだと、「#Num!」と表示されます。
> 
> この場合、空白表示にしたいのです。

タイトルRe^2: フォーム画面の「#Num!」を空白表示したい
記事No83326
投稿日: 2018/07/22(Sun) 15:54
投稿者AccessKid
> > 結果の型は、「倍精度浮動小数点型」

ああ。これは通貨型のほうが良いと思いますよ。

Accessのテーブルでは扱う数値に応じてデータ型を使い分ける
https://dekiru.net/article/14891/

- 以下のフォームから自分の投稿記事を修正・削除することができます -
処理 記事No パスワード

ページの先頭へ 前ページへ戻る